Steam with a mass flow rate of 200,000 lb/hr enters a well insulated turbine at 1100 psi, 900degreeF through a duct with a flow area of 1ft^2. A portion of the steam is extracted at p=130psi,T=380degreeF and exits through a 1 ft diameter duct at v=60ft/s. The remaining steam exits at an exhaust pressure of 1 psi with a quality of 90% and a velocity of 500ft/s. For the turbine find: a. the velocity at the turbine inlet. b. The portion of original mass flow extracted. c. the power produced by the turbine d. the diameter of the exhaust duct?
